A Brief History of the INFINITI FX50

The mid-sized luxury crossover SUV debuted in 2009 as a second-generation model in the brand's FX series. Power was delivered to the intelligent all-wheel drive by a 395-horsepower V8 engine that mated to a seven-speed automatic transmission. Packed with state-of-the-art technology and enveloped in luxury, the crossover delivered the comfort and performance owners still relish.

INFINITI FX50 Parts and Accessories FAQs

When did INFINITI discontinue the FX50?

Production ceased with 2013 models, as the crossover became the INFINITI QX70 for 2014. Fortunately, though, we have a comprehensive selection of the genuine INFINITI parts and accessories you want.

What are common INFINITI FX50 problems?

The most-reported concerns include the "Check Engine" dash light coming on due to a faulty powertrain control module or a weak battery, an issue with the transfer case, or unusually harsh gear downshifting.

Have there been any recalls issued for the FX50?

INFINITI has issued one recall to date, for a potential oil leak on the 2011 model. Repairs began in early 2012, so if your model was affected the repairs have likely already taken place. If you don't have records indicating so, enter your VIN at the Transport Canada website. If your search results in a message stating, "0 unrepaired recalls associated with this VIN," the recall has been repaired.
